Job Description:

Hitachi Rail is looking for an enthusiastic, self-motivated Mechanical Integration Engineer who thrives in a fast-paced engineering environment. Based in Hagerstown, Maryland. You will play a key role in shaping the integration of advanced rolling stock systems, ensuring designs move seamlessly from concept through to manufacture. This is an exciting opportunity to work on large-scale, high-profile rail projects, collaborating with multidisciplinary teams and international colleagues to deliver innovative and reliable engineering solutions.

Accountabilities

Main tasks & the responsibilities include but not limited to:

  • Carry out 3D mechanical integration analysis across train components, producing clear and actionable reports
  • Lead the development and integration of mechanical systems, including supplier collaboration and co-design activities
  • Manage and maintain the full train digital mock-up in 3D CAD environments
  • Develop and oversee tolerance stack-up analysis to ensure successful system integration
  • Produce full train assembly drawings to support manufacturing processes
  • Design mechanical components such as frames, brackets, and supporting structures
  • Collaborate effectively with internal teams and external partners to deliver engineering excellence.

Required Skills/ Knowledge

  • 3-5 years of experience in Mechanical Integration Engineer
  • Degree in Mechanical Engineering or equivalent technical background
  • Strong experience with 3D CAD tools (e.g. Creo, CATIA, Autodesk)
  • Ability to work independently and adapt to a dynamic, fast-changing environment
  • Strong teamwork and communication skills with the ability to collaborate across disciplines
  • Proficiency in standard engineering and office tools (Word, Excel, etc.)

Desired Skills/ Knowledge

  • Knowledge of railway vehicle systems and integration principles
  • Familiarity with engineering processes and requirements management tools (e.g. DOORS)
  • Understanding of rail standards and regulations
  • Passion for the rail industry and continuous improvement
  • Willingness to travel occasionally for business requirements

Education/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s or master’s degree in mechanical engineering or equivalent technical background.
